  • Norilsk Nickel, the Russian nickel and palladium producer, is refinancing an existing $2.5bn facility. According to bankers, the new deal will have tighter margins than the original deal, which boasted the slimmest margins of any Russian syndicated loan in 2017. Some bankers are calling this the busiest January they have seen for years in the Russian market.
